Abstract
The effects of six different nitrogen sources on enzyme activity in carbon and nitrogen metabolism, and chemical composition in flue - cured tobacco were studied at four different growth stages. The results showed that the activities of nitrate reductase (NR) and invertase (Inv) were always high during the full growth period when the mixture fertilizer of ammonium nitrate and sesame cake was applied. However, the α- amylase activity showed low at early growth stage but increased at late growth stage. It was good for the accumulation of dry matter and timely maturity of tobacco leaves. Also, the chemical composition and ratio of cured tobacco were more appropriate in this situation. The high - quality tobacco could be harvested more easily based on this.
